Jab planter user manual

Hand-jab planters are popular amongst small-scale farmers. They are the primary means of sowing seeds under no-tillage for most farmers. The implement is also suitable for filling in gaps after crop germination. There are many different models of jab planters from different companies. The operational principles are however similar. The implement may have either separate hoppers for seed and fertilizer or one hopper for seed only. This practice includes a user manual for jab planter, describing how to operate and maintain a jab planter.

1. How to operate a jab planter

  • The action of pulling the handles apart triggers the seeds/fertilizer to be conveyed from the hopper to temporarily settle at the furrow opener (the beak). This action occurs simultaneously with piercing/punching the soil.
  • The second action which occurs immediately after the first one is pulling the handles together. This action triggers the opening of the furrow opener (beak) in order to deliver the seed/fertilizer in the created planting furrow. The action also triggers the closing of the seed/fertilizer metering devices.
  • These two actions are undertaken repeatedly, and they have to be synchronized with the operator’s footsteps in order to achieve the desired plant population.
  • The operator will need to carefully listen to the dropping sounds made at every action to ascertain that indeed the implement is planting and there is no blockage.
  • The operator will have to use his / her judgment of the weight to re-fill the seed/fertilizer hoppers accordingly when they are about to be emptied.
  • Seeding rates can be adjusted according to the number of holes in the seed plate that are exposed to the outlet.

2. How to maintain a jab planter

  • Prior to any operation, the implement must be calibrated for the specific seed to be planted. Several seed plate sizes are available and the operator will have to select the one with holes that fit the particular seed. Seeding rates can be adjusted accordingly. There is a provision to plant one, two or three seeds per hole. This is achieved by positioning the pin in any of the three holes.
  • The implement must be cleaned and dried properly after every operation and stored in a cool dry place.
  • Where possible, apply graphite on the seed plate. This acts as a lubricant for the moving parts to minimize tear and wear.
  • The implement is mostly suited to dry, light or soft mulch covered soils. It is unlikely to work well in muddy or surface crusted soils.

3. Why do we need a jab planter?

  • Part of the attraction of hand-jab planters is that they do not require access to animal or tractor power, are low cost, light and easy to operate, although some skill is required and for these reasons, they are often accessible to women.
  • Enormous labour is saved by the use of jab planter. The work done by three to four people under conventional tillage is done by one person. One person is able to planter 1 fedan in two to three hours, saving valuable time that enables farmers to plant in time under conservation agriculture.
  • With direct seeding by the jab planter, there is minimal (less than 5 percent) soil disturbance, so weed germination is minimized.
  • The small size of the devices makes them suitable for operation on hilly, stony and stumpy areas and for intercropping.
